OpenGov is the leader in AI and ERP solutions for local and state governments in the U.S. More than 2,000 cities, counties, state agencies, school districts, and special districts rely on the OpenGov Public Service Platform to operate efficiently, adapt to change, and strengthen the public trust. Category-leading products include enterprise asset management, procurement and contract management, accounting and budgeting, billing and revenue management, permitting and licensing, and transparency and open data. These solutions come together in the OpenGov ERP, allowing public sector organizations to focus on priorities and deliver maximum ROI with every dollar and decision in sync. Learn about OpenGov’s mission to power more effective and accountable government and the vision of high-performance government for every community at OpenGov.com http://OpenGov.com. JOB SUMMARY We’re hiring a Workplace Manager to serve as the site lead for daily operations and workplace experience, partnering directly with Boston leadership to align the physical workplace with business objectives at our growing Boston office. This is a hands-on, people-first role for someone who brings operational precision, a hospitality mindset, and genuine passion for building environments where people do their best work - and who is energized by the autonomy to make it happen. At OpenGov, our offices are extensions of our culture. As Culture Champion of our Boston office, you will manage the full spectrum of office needs - from vendors and facilities to events and employee experience - while building and scaling the programs and processes that grow with us. You’ll collaborate with peers across our office portfolio and step in to remotely support other locations as needed.
